Adidas x Kanye West Fashion Show

February 13, 2015

Yesterday, models walked onto the runway and stood in rows while Kanye West made his Adidas x Kanye West presentation. My first thought - ballerina meets Game of Thrones meets great camping garments! I guess the head-to-toe leotards, knee high socks and bunched boots kinda threw me off at first, but all that aside, each garment displayed atop the leo's screamed Kanye West and his personal style. I like West's style and I loved the show - I might even buy my first Adidas garment in the fall.. There were fifty looks that showcased the men in layers of clothes, slouchy pants, oversized sweaters and nice selection of coats. The women's looks consisted of oversized garments atop sports bras, body suits and leotards - the looks were casual (kinda frumpy), but cool and modern. Day one of New York fashion week fall/winter 2015 and the Adidas x Kanye West "off-beat street fashion" show has already made a big impression.

Alexa Chung for AG

January 15, 2015

The much anticipated collection by Alexa Chung for Adriano Goldschmied is now available on-line at NET-A-PORTER, Matchesfashion and Mytheresa. The 20 piece collection will be available in stores on January 20th. British model and fashion icon Alexa Chung has collaborated with denim brand AG to create a casual collection with a 60's vibe of denim jeans (of course), short dresses, overalls and a mini skirt, as well as sweaters and t-shirts. Alexa Chung has a unique personal style coveted by many, including myself! I've been checking on-line daily for additional items to become available (it's selling out faster than I search). I have to have the denim shirtdress and denim skirt overall.. wish me luck.

The collection will be available at Adriano Goldschmied, Anthropologie, major department stores; Bloomingdales, SAKS, Nordstrom, Neiman Marcus and Bergdorf Goodman. It will also be available on-line at Revolve, Stylebop, Mytheresa and Avenue 32.

Fashions Finest On-Line Shopping

October 12, 2014

I'm an avid on-line shopper! I make 85% of my fashion and cosmetics purchases on-line, rather than visiting malls or shopping street side stores. Shopping on-line is superior to in-store shopping mostly due to the vast selection and ability to search for items unavailable in your area. 

On-line apparel and accessory sites like Shopbop and NET-A-PORTER publish lookbooks that showcase items from various designers/labels together - it's like having a personal stylist. The photos provided for each item allow you to see how the garments fit and which items to pair it with. Clothes look better on a model than on a hanger.. I luv lookbooks! Magazines are also a great media for inspiration and list every item, so you can search the internet and purchase anything that is published. Harpers Bazaar magazine has launched an on-line shopping site that allows readers to browse and purchase many of the items in the magazine. My fashion inspiration often comes from magazines and lookbooks.

My morning ritual consists of coffee and browsing on-line shopping sites. First on my list is Shopbop. This site carries many of my favorite designers/labels and posts new items each day. Shopbop stylists have great taste and showcase different brands together well. There is a section under each item "wear it with" that allows you to recreate the outfit pictured. Shopbop also publishes great lookbooks daily. They currently have 862 brands (I counted), such as Alice + Olivia, Phillip Lim, Elizabeth and James, as well as premiere designer names like Saint Laurent and Marchesa. Shopbop has a vast selection to suit everyones personal style. Shopbop has free shipping and returns. Included in your package you will find a prepaid return label that ensures a free return if you send the item back within seven days of receiving it. This allows you enough time to try on your items and decide whether you will keep them. 

I recently discovered NET-A-PORTER and quickly became obsessed with browsing the new arrivals, the magazine's page, and the stylish combinations of apparel and accessories showcased listed under "how to wear it". Each item has photos from many angles, up close so you can see the material and full body shots. What sets NET-A-PORTER apart are the videos posted next to each item showcasing the look. NET-A-PORTER has brands I haven't seen on another on-line shopping site, like Kate Moss for Topshop, and high brands such as Victoria Beckham, Stella McCartney and Proenza Schouler. If anything, this site will inspire you!

For premiere designer items my go-to on-line shopping site is Shop Bazaar. If I had to sum up this site in one word - trendy! There are currently 330 brands including Burberry Prorsum, Dolce & Gabbana, Emilio Pucci, The Row... It's designer apparel and accessories heaven! There is a "In the Magazine" page featuring items from the latest edition, as well as a "Trends" page for current fashion inspiration.
